Brief summary
The primary objective of this study is to evaluate the long-term safety and tolerability of ALKS 8700 for the treatment of Relapsing Remitting Multiple Sclerosis (RRMS). The secondary objective of this study is to evaluate treatment effect over time in adult participants with RRMS treated with ALKS 8700.

Annualized Relapse Rate (ARR)
Relapse was defined as new or recurrent neurologic symptoms, not associated with fever or infection, lasting for at least 24 hours, accompanied by one or more of the following: New objective neurological findings upon examination by the treating neurologist that are functionally consistent with findings on the Expanded Disability Status Scale \[EDSS\] (performed within 7 days of onset of symptoms) with an increase over the prior visit of ≥ 0.5 for the total score, an increase of ≥ 2 in 1 functional system (FS), except bladder/cognitive changes, and/or, an increase of ≥ 1 in 2 FS, except bladder/cognitive changes. The relapse rate for an individual participant was calculated as the number of relapses for that participant divided by the number of participant-years followed. The ARR for each enrollment group was calculated as the total number of relapses experienced in the group divided by the total number of participant-years on study.
Time frame: Up to 96 weeks
Population: Safety Analysis Set included all enrolled participants who received at least one dose of ALKS 8700.
| Arm | Measure | Value (NUMBER) |
|---|---|---|
| De Novo | Annualized Relapse Rate (ARR) | 0.14 relapses per participant year |
| Rollover: ALKS 8700 | Annualized Relapse Rate (ARR) | 0.11 relapses per participant year |
| Rollover: DMF | Annualized Relapse Rate (ARR) | 0.13 relapses per participant year |
Change From Baseline in Expanded Disability Status Scale (EDSS) Score
The EDSS is used to measure and evaluate MS participants' level of functioning. The EDSS provides a total score on a scale that ranges from 0 to 10. The first levels 1.0 to 4.5 refer to people with a high degree of ambulatory ability and the subsequent levels 5.0 to 9.5 refer to the loss of ambulatory ability. The range of main categories include (0) = normal neurologic examination; to (5) = ambulatory without aid or rest for 200 meters; disability severe enough to impair full daily activities; to (10) = death due to MS. Higher scores indicate more disability. Positive change from baseline indicates more disability.

Change From Baseline in Timed 25-Foot Walk Test (T25-FW) Score
The T25-FW is a reliable quantitative mobility and leg function performance test based on a timed 25-foot walk. The participant was directed to one end of a clearly marked 25-foot course and was instructed to walk 25 feet as quickly as possible, but safely. Participants were allowed to use assistive devices (canes, crutches, walkers) as needed. The time was calculated from when the lead foot crosses the start point to when the participant had reached the 25-foot mark. The task was immediately administered again by having the participant walk back the same distance. The score for the T25-FW was calculated as the average of the 2 completed trials. A negative change from Baseline indicates improvement.

Percentage of Participants With No Evidence of Disease Activity (NEDA) at Week 96
The definition of NEDA-3 encompasses a combination of the following 3 related measures of disease activity: No relapses, no confirmed disability progression sustained for 12 weeks as measured on EDSS, and no magnetic resonance imaging (MRI) disease activity, defined as no gadolinium-enhancing (GdE) lesions and no new or enlarging T2 lesions. The definition of NEDA-4 was the above definition of NEDA-3 with the addition of a mean annualized rate of brain volume loss of less than 0.4% where annualized rate of brain volume loss was derived from percentage brain volume change (PBVC) from baseline and was calculated as (\[PBVC/100+1\]\^\[365.25/days\]-1) × 100.
Time frame: Week 96
Population: Safety Analysis Set included all enrolled participants who received at least one dose of ALKS 8700. 'Number Analyzed' signifies number of participants analyzed for this outcome measure at the specified timepoint.
| Arm | Measure | Group | Value (NUMBER) |
|---|---|---|---|
| De Novo | Percentage of Participants With No Evidence of Disease Activity (NEDA) at Week 96 | NEDA-3 | 24.8 percentage of participants |
| De Novo | Percentage of Participants With No Evidence of Disease Activity (NEDA) at Week 96 | NEDA-4 | 14.3 percentage of participants |
| Rollover: ALKS 8700 | Percentage of Participants With No Evidence of Disease Activity (NEDA) at Week 96 | NEDA-3 | 34.6 percentage of participants |
| Rollover: ALKS 8700 | Percentage of Participants With No Evidence of Disease Activity (NEDA) at Week 96 | NEDA-4 | 15.2 percentage of participants |
| Rollover: DMF | Percentage of Participants With No Evidence of Disease Activity (NEDA) at Week 96 | NEDA-3 | 28.6 percentage of participants |
| Rollover: DMF | Percentage of Participants With No Evidence of Disease Activity (NEDA) at Week 96 | NEDA-4 | 11.9 percentage of participants |
Time to Onset of 12-week Confirmed Disability Progression
The time to onset of 12-week confirmed disability progression is defined as the time from baseline to the first disability progression that is confirmed at the next regularly scheduled visit ≥ 12 weeks after the initial disability progression. Disability progression is defined by one of the following: an EDSS increase of at least 1.5 points from baseline EDSS = 0, an EDSS increase of at least a 1.0 point from baseline EDSS between 1.0 and 5.5 (inclusive), or an EDSS increase of at least 0.5 points from baseline EDSS = 6.0.
Time frame: Up to Week 96
Population: FAS included all participants who received at least one dose of ALKS 8700 and had at least one post-baseline efficacy assessment. 'Number of Participants Analyzed' signifies number of participants analyzed for this outcome measure.
| Arm | Measure | Value (MEDIAN) |
|---|---|---|
| De Novo | Time to Onset of 12-week Confirmed Disability Progression | 250.0 days |
| Rollover: ALKS 8700 | Time to Onset of 12-week Confirmed Disability Progression | 254.5 days |
| Rollover: DMF | Time to Onset of 12-week Confirmed Disability Progression | 176.0 days |
